Where to Use Caution
No design is universal, and there are specific situations where you need to exercise judgment:
- Small Hoop Sizes: If you are working with tiny hoops (like 4x4 inches), be mindful of the smallest text elements. Fine details can get lost or become difficult to stitch cleanly if the scale is too small. Always test at the actual production size.
- Textured and Stretchy Fabrics: On chunky knits or highly textured weaves, the definition of the quote may soften. Similarly, on stretchy fabrics like jersey, ensure you are using a proper stabilizer to prevent distortion. The design itself is stable, but the fabric movement can ruin the alignment.
- Curved Surfaces: Applying this to caps or curved hat fronts requires careful positioning. The flat nature of the digital design needs to be mentally mapped onto a 3D curve. Centering the quote correctly is vital for a polished look.
- Dense Stitch Areas: While generally balanced, avoid placing overlapping designs too close together. Let the negative space breathe to maintain clarity.

Practical Designer Notes for Implementation
Before you rush into production mode, keep these practical tips in mind:
- Test on Scrap Fabric: Never run a full production batch without testing the design on the exact fabric you plan to sell. Check how the thread interacts with the material grain.
- Check Thread Contrast: Ensure your thread colors provide sufficient contrast against the fabric. A light grey quote on white fabric might lack impact. Choose threads that pop.
- Review Stitch Density: If you are digitizing these vectors yourself, pay attention to the underlay and top stitch density. Adjust settings based on fabric weight.
- Confirm Licensing: This is critical. Before selling any custom apparel or personalized gifts made from these files, verify the commercial license terms. Ensure you are allowed to sell finished goods and understand any restrictions on digital resale.
- Inspect Small Details: Zoom in on the SVG files. Are the anchor points clean? Are there any stray nodes that could cause jumping or needle breaks?
